概括
与仅使用传统香烟的人相比,使用传统香烟和电子香烟的拉丁裔成年人报告了更高的疼痛严重程度和干扰. 这突显了这种人群中疼痛和双重烟草制品使用之间的潜在联系.
科学领域:
- 公共卫生 公共卫生
- 控制烟草的控制方式
- 健康差异 在健康上的差异
背景情况:
- 拉丁人是一个健康差异小组,涉及到烟草的使用.
- 在拉丁美洲人群中,关于双重燃烧和电子烟使用的研究有限.
- 在拉丁裔吸烟者中,疼痛问题很普遍,并且与吸烟行为有关.
研究的目的:
- 为了比较拉丁语样本中双可燃/电子烟使用者和独家可燃香烟使用者之间的疼痛严重程度和干扰水平.
- 扩大Latinx社区对双重烟草制品使用的有限研究.
主要方法:
- 对196名成年拉丁裔每日吸烟者的横截面研究.
- 参与者被分为双重使用者 (可燃性烟和电子烟) 或独家可燃性烟使用者.
- 评估了疼痛严重程度和干扰,并在各组之间进行了比较.
主要成果:
- 196名参与者中有72人 (36.7%) 是当前的每日双重使用者.
- 拉丁语双重使用者报告的疼痛严重程度明显高 (η2 = .12) 比独家使用者.
- 拉丁语双重用户也报告了明显更大的疼痛干扰 (η2 = .10) 比独家用户.
结论:
- 双重可燃和电子烟的使用与拉丁裔吸烟者中较高的疼痛严重程度和干扰有关.
- 疼痛可能是启动和维持双重烟草制品使用的风险因素.
- 研究结果强调了在拉丁双重使用者的戒烟干预中解决疼痛的临床重要性.
